Mastering the Short Game: Breaking 90 in Golf

Learn how to strategically navigate a golf course under 170 yards and break 90 by focusing on accuracy and shot strategy.

00:00:00 Learn how to break 90 by strategically choosing clubs and plotting your way around the course. Manage the game and focus on accuracy rather than distance.

🏌️ You can break 90 in golf without hitting the ball more than 170 yards by using the right clubs and strategic thinking.

πŸ” Focus on playing to the middle to back distance of the green to avoid falling short and aim for the back edge of every green.

β›³ Course management, choosing the right shots, and making confident putts are key to breaking 90 in golf.

00:28:45 Learn how to break 90 step by step in this golf tutorial. Avoid water hazards by hitting to the back edge and carry them with a mediocre strike. Improve your chipping and putting to score better.

🏌️ Focus on hitting the back edge of the green to ensure clearing the water hazard and avoid sucker pins.

β›³ Experiment with tee height to find what works best for your shots and ball flight preferences.

🏞️ Clear your mind of water hazards by focusing on targets further away and building confidence through practice.

00:34:27 Learn how to navigate tricky chip shots and improve your chances of breaking 90 in golf. Understand the slopes, aim for 4-6 feet from the pin, and use an open-face technique. Strategize your course, avoid hazards, and focus on stress-free shots for success.

Understanding the difficulty of a chip shot and aiming for a result of 4-5 feet is ideal.

When facing a long par four, strategically aiming to stay short of bunkers and pitching onto the green can help avoid double chipping and improve overall score.

By focusing on stress-free shots, avoiding hazards, and planning each shot carefully, it is possible to break 90 in golf.
